My take away from the fight is this "chin" problem that Vargas now has is going to be a career long issue. It wasn't a congenital thing though. Vargas can thank Tito for it. Now, if Vargas gets hit right, and that is something that's always a possibility because he's so offensive minded and is always in the pocket so to speak, he's going down. Trinidad dented his chin forever. Kind of like what Big George did to Joe Frazier. Prior to that fight, Frazier had a granite jaw. After that fight, Frazier was susceptible to being hurt if caught right at any time in a bout.

For Vargas' foes though, keeping him down and putting him out is another matter completely. Vargas is a very tough guy. And he's one of the best offensive fighters in the game. Rivera was very tricky in there and gets off his punches quickly and sharply. More importantly, Rivera was there to win last night. He was far from an opponent. Vargas put some real hurt on him and gave him a pretty severe beating.

I have to disagree with The HBO crew on Vargas' choosing too tough a guy and coming back too soon after the Trinidad loss. This was a good fight for Vargas. Should Vargas have waited a year and fought some soft touch he would've KO'd in 2 rds for a confidence builder? The chin issue would've been exposed in a big fight situation instead somewhere down the line. Better that he learn now and focus on improving his defense to be better prepared for a big fight down the line.
